什么是数据库
数据库(Database)是指按照一定的数据模型组织、存储和管理数据的仓库。可以将数据库看作是一个电子化的文件柜,其中可以存储大量的结构化和非结构化数据。通过数据库管理系统(DBMS),用户可以方便地对数据库进行访问、查询、更新和管理。
数据库的类型
关系型数据库(RDBMS)是最常用的数据库类型之一。它使用表格的形式来组织数据,数据存储在表中的行和列中。每张表都有一个唯一的标识符(主键),可以通过主键来建立不同表之间的关系。
非关系型数据库(NoSQL)是另一种常见的数据库类型。与关系型数据库不同,非关系型数据库不使用表格来组织数据,而是使用其他的数据结构,例如键值对、文档、列族等。非关系型数据库通常用于处理大规模和高并发的数据。
分布式数据库是一种将数据分散存储在多个节点上的数据库系统。分布式数据库可以提高数据的可靠性和可扩展性。各个节点之间通过网络进行通信和数据同步,保证数据的一致性和可用性。
数据库的优势
数据集中管理:数据库允许将数据集中存储在一个地方,便于管理和维护。用户可以通过DBMS从数据库中获取所需的数据,无需手动处理大量的数据文件。
数据共享和共同更新:在数据库中,多个用户可以同时访问和更新数据。数据库管理系统会协调不同用户之间的操作,保证数据的一致性和完整性。这使得多个用户可以共同使用和更新数据,提高工作效率。
数据安全性:数据库可以提供各种安全机制来保护数据的机密性、完整性和可用性。用户可以通过角色和权限管理来限制对数据的访问和操作,防止未经授权的使用和篡改数据。
数据备份和恢复:数据库管理系统通常提供数据备份和恢复的功能。通过定期备份数据库,可以在数据丢失或损坏时快速恢复数据。这是保护数据不丢失的重要手段。
高性能和扩展性:数据库系统经过优化和索引,可以提供快速的数据查询和处理能力。同时,数据库可以随着数据量的增长进行扩展,保证系统的性能和可靠性。
总结
数据库是一种按照数据模型组织、存储和管理数据的仓库,通过数据库管理系统进行访问和管理。关系型数据库、非关系型数据库和分布式数据库是常见的数据库类型。数据库具有数据集中管理、数据共享和共同更新、数据安全性、数据备份和恢复、高性能和扩展性等优势。通过使用数据库,可以更方便地处理和管理大量的数据。
温馨提示:应版权方要求,违规内容链接已处理或移除!